Somerville Police Looking For Armed Robbery Suspect
Boston Convenience was stolen from in late March.

SOMERVILLE, MA — The police department announced Thursday that it is looking to identify a person it believes was involved in an armed robbery that took place at 6 Broadway in late March.
The person was captured on surveillance footage on Tuesday, March 24, at approximately 12:30 p.m., the day of the reported incident. According to police, he is a man with dark hair and a gray beard. He was seen wearing a tan Carhartt sweatshirt, a black baseball hat, a partial face covering, and dark pants.
$900 was stolen from Boston Convenience as a result of the theft. The store owners expressed their surprise that the incident occurred in the middle of the day, and their relief that their employee was not harmed. Cashier Anju Rani said she was held at knifepoint by the assailant while he raided two cash registers.
